This graphite drawing by A. Goedkoop depicts the Ruijterkade in Amsterdam, a site historically associated with the city's maritime activity. The composition captures the bustling atmosphere of the quay, where steamships are moored alongside the wooden piers. The artist employs a delicate, precise line to delineate the structural details of the vessels, the smoke rising from their funnels, and the architectural elements of the waterfront buildings.
The drawing provides a clear view of the industrial character of the Amsterdam harbour during the period. Goedkoop focuses on the interplay between the solid forms of the ships and the reflective surface of the water, using light shading to suggest the depth of the harbour and the atmospheric conditions of the day. The inclusion of small figures on the quay adds a sense of scale and human presence to the scene, grounding the industrial subject matter in daily life.
Technically, the work demonstrates a disciplined approach to draughtsmanship. The artist uses varying pressure to distinguish between the foreground stonework, the mid-ground vessels, and the distant horizon. The composition is balanced, with the weight of the ships on the right countered by the quay and buildings on the left. This piece serves as a record of the urban development of Amsterdam, documenting the transition of the waterfront into a modern transit hub. The lack of heavy contrast allows the viewer to focus on the structural integrity of the ships and the quiet, observational quality of the artist's gaze. It is a work of historical interest for those studying the maritime heritage of the Netherlands.
